LTN consultation reopened until January

The consultation on the Fox Lane low-traffic neighbourhood (LTN) in Southgate and Palmers Green has been reopened for a further two months until 11th January 2022. As reported in the Enfield Dispatch Enfield Dispatch | Fresh row over LTN as consultation reopened

Conservative councillor Maria Alexandrou, who represents Winchmore Hill ward where part of the Fox Lane LTN is located, said she was not given advance warning about the consultation being reopened.

She told the Local Democracy Reporting Service: “The council put posters in Fox Lane saying people can object until 11th January, but they did not tell the councillors. I had residents ringing me telling me this. I had no idea this was going on. They [the council] sent an email the next day.”
